What are the drawbacks of the management information system?
The major drawback of the management information system is that it cannot meet the special demands of each person. Mostly, the management information system doesn’t provide exact information and the concept of decision support system was created in response to such need (McLoyd, 1999).
Why is information management important to an organization?
Information management allows organizations to be more efficient by sharing the information throughout the company. This prompts an organization to act as a team, in which every member has access to the knowledge base of others. Information management is rarely problem-free, however.
What are the functions of Information Technology Management?
IT management requires typical management functions as related to staffing, budget, control and organization and also includes functions unique to the IT environment, such as software development, network planning and tech support.
